Gender and sex can be related for some. The expectation that if you’re assigned male at birth, you’re a man, and that if you’re assigned female at birth, you’re a woman, lines up for people who are cisgender. Although a majority of people in our society do identify as men or women, there’s a wide range of possibilities between and beyond the two. Some people identify as nonbinary, an umbrella term for people whose gender identities don’t align with the man-woman binary.
For starters, here are some terms I use throughout this podcast...
privilege: a special right, advantage, or immunity granted or available only to a particular person or group.
intersectionality: the interconnected nature of social categorizations such as race, class, and gender as they apply to a given individual or group, regarded as creating overlapping and interdependent systems of discrimination or disadvantage.
social justice: the view that everyone deserves equal economic, political and social rights and opportunities.
gender: the socially constructed roles, behaviors, expressions and identities of girls, women, boys, men, and gender diverse people. It influences how people perceive themselves and each other, how they act and interact, and the distribution of power and resources in society.
binary: relating to, composed of, or involving two things.
oppression: the state of being subject to unjust treatment or control.
